“Older adults’ net worth surges following pandemic”

Older adults’ net worth surges following pandemic,” by Kathleen Steele Gaivin, McKnights Senior Living

“Home and stock prices have increased substantially since the COVID-19 pandemic, resulting in a $91,000 median increase in net worth between 2019 and 2022 for households headed by someone aged 65 or more years. That’s according to Bloomberg, which cited research from the Federal Reserve Bank of St. Louis that used data from the Fed’s Survey of Consumer Finances.”
